About the role
Job Title
Electricians Mates
Summary
We’re seeking experienced Electricians Mates to join a busy Data Centre project in Slough.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als with electrical site experience who want consistent hours, overtime opportunities, and weekend shifts.
Salary
PAYE Rates
Monday to Friday (First 37.5 Hours)
Basic Rate: £17.58 per hour
Holiday Pay: £2.47 per hour
Total Payable: £20.05 per hour
Midweek Overtime, First 6 Hours on Saturday
Basic Rate: £22.85 per hour
Holiday Pay: £3.21 per hour
Total Payable: £26.06 per hour
Saturday After 6 Hours & Sundays
Basic Rate: £26.37 per hour
Holiday Pay: £3.70 per hour
Total Payable: £30.07 per hour
Umbrella Rates
Monday to Friday (First 37.5 Hours)
£23.76 per hour
Midweek Overtime, First 6 Hours on Saturday & Bank Holidays
£30.88 per hour
Saturday After 6 Hours & Sundays
£35.64 per hour
Location and Working Pattern
Location: Slough, SL1
Monday to Friday: 7:30am – 6:00pm (30 minutes deducted per day for breaks)
Weekend work (every other weekend): 7:30am – 4:00pm
Free parking available (limited on-site, wider estate parking options)
Burnham Railway Station – 9-minute walk from site
Client Overview
Our client is delivering an advanced Data Centre project and requires skilled personnel to support containment and electrical installation works to agreed timelines.
Responsibilities
Assist electricians with daily duties on-site
Install containment systems
Carry out conduit installations
Support general electrical installation tasks
Help maintain a safe and efficient work environment
Must-have Requirements
Valid ECS Electrical Labourer Card
IPAF Licence
Previous experience on electrical installation sites
Nice-to-have Skills
Knowledge of Data Centre environments
Ability to interpret technical drawings
Additional electrical certifications
